Re: Host migration and restarting wave

I'm on PC.

When the host leaves, 95% of the time I find myself as a new host with 0-2 of the other players joining the restarted wave.  (There have been a number of times where the host leaves, and then the group of 4 turns into a solo match for me, usually I'll get all the other players though).

4% of the time I end up joining another host.

1% of the time I'll get your experience where I get kicked to the multiplayer menu.

Sounds like you are experiencing an unusual issue.

I'm guessing it determines that somebody else should be the host, but you end up having trouble communicating with their PC so it boots you to the Main Menu.  Traditionally, firewall settings were causes of peer-to-peer connection issues.  I have no idea what the source of your issues are.
